Berwick name meaning:

The name Berwick is of English origin, derived from a surname that was taken from various places in England and Scotland. The etymology of Berwick is rooted in the Old English words "bere," which means "barley," and "wic," referring to a farm or a village. Thus, the name Berwick can be translated to mean "barley farm" or "barley village," indicating a location where barley was a significant crop or a mainstay of the local economy.
